trying different approaches to test layout. in this one, the testing modules
become an externally usable package but still remains within the main sqlalchemy parent package. in this system, we use kind of an ugly hack to get the noseplugin imported outside of the "sqlalchemy" package, while still making it available within sqlalchemy for usage by third party libraries.

+class TestBase(object):
+ # A sequence of database names to always run, regardless of the
+ # constraints below.
+ __whitelist__ = ()
+
+ # A sequence of requirement names matching testing.requires decorators
+ __requires__ = ()
+
+ # A sequence of dialect names to exclude from the test class.
+ __unsupported_on__ = ()
+
+ # If present, test class is only runnable for the *single* specified
+ # dialect. If you need multiple, use __unsupported_on__ and invert.
+ __only_on__ = None
+
+ # A sequence of no-arg callables. If any are True, the entire testcase is
+ # skipped.
+ __skip_if__ = None
+
+ def assert_(self, val, msg=None):
+ assert val, msg
+
